Supervisor::RPC::Client - The client interface to the Supervisors environment
use Supervisor::RPC::Client; my $rpc = Supervisor::RPC::Client->new() my $result = $rpc->start('sleeper');
This is the client module for external access to the Supervisor. It provides methods to start/stop/reload and retrieve the status of managed processes.
This initilaize the module and can take two parameters.
Example: my $rpc = Supervisor::RPC::Client->new( -port => 9505, -address => 'localhost' };
This method will start a managed process. It takes one parameter, the name of the process, and returns "started" if successful.
Example: my $result = $rpc->start('sleeper');
This method will stop a managed process. It takes one parameter, the name of the process, and returns "stopped" if successful.
Example: my $result = $rpc->stop('sleeper');
This method will do a "stat" on a managed process. It takes one parameter, the name of the process, and returns "alive" if the process is running or "dead" if the process is not.
This method will attempt to "reload" a managed process. It takes one parameter, the name of the process. It will return "reloaded".
Example: my $result = $rpc->reload('sleeper');
